The most surprising revelation from NASA’s Curiosity Mars Rover — that methane is seeping from the surface of Gale Crater — has scientists scratching their heads. Living creatures produce most of the methane on Earth. But scientists haven’t found convincing signs of current or ancient life on Mars, and thus didn’t expect to find methane […]
April 22, 2024
from NASA https://ift.tt/GW0rLaj
via IFTTT
No comments:
Post a Comment